The best application techniques for using oil-based paint on metal surfaces include cleaning the surface thoroughly, applying a primer specifically designed for metal, using a high-quality brush or roller, applying thin and even coats, and allowing sufficient drying time between coats.

What techniques can be used to achieve a verdigris patina on metal surfaces?

To achieve a verdigris patina on metal surfaces, techniques such as applying a mixture of vinegar and salt, using a solution of ammonia and salt, or using a commercial patina solution can be used. These techniques involve creating a chemical reaction on the metal surface to produce the greenish-blue verdigris color.

What are the best techniques for applying rust-resistant paint to metal surfaces?

The best techniques for applying rust-resistant paint to metal surfaces include proper surface preparation, using a primer specifically designed for metal, applying multiple thin coats of paint, and allowing sufficient drying time between coats. Additionally, using a paint sprayer or brush designed for metal surfaces can help achieve a smooth and even finish.


What are the different techniques used to achieve a brush finish on metal surfaces?

To achieve a brush finish on metal surfaces, various techniques can be used, including hand brushing, machine brushing, sanding, and wire brushing. These methods involve rubbing the metal surface with abrasive materials to create a textured finish that resembles brush strokes.

How can I effectively paint metal doors?

To effectively paint metal doors, you should first clean the surface thoroughly, sand it to create a smooth finish, apply a primer designed for metal surfaces, and then use a high-quality paint specifically made for metal. Make sure to follow the manufacturer's instructions for drying times and application techniques to achieve a durable and professional-looking finish.
